After Carl Kauba (Austrian/American, 1865-1922)

Reclining Indian Smoking a Pipe
. Signed "© Kauba" in the bronze in the blanket behind the figure's knees. Cold-painted bronze, 10 3/8 x 4 1/8 x 3 in. Condition: Missing and bent pieces, wear and losses to paint surfaces, dirt and grime.
Estimate $1,000-1,500

The rifle is bent. There are losses to the paint throughout the work, and the surface could use cleaning as well.
